Main Streets Revitalization: Smart Investments

Many communities in Wisconsin are targeting their commercial center and downtown to revitalize. The investment in infrastructure, façade improvement grants and enhancement of public spaces bring businesses and visitors. These investments help develop dynamic economic centres that bring about long-term investments.
